This concept of sub-objects also shows up in the 'restrict' stuff. The difference is that with 'restrict' the aliasing constraints are dynamic: the promise is that e.g. two (dynamic) accesses in the original program don't alias. Here the constrains are static.

Ideally we would have a single solution for all this stuff, but instead right now we have multiple disjoint solutions. Each one will have to go through the pain of patching all optimizers so they understand the new intrinsics so they don't throttle back. It's not ideal..

Regarding this patch in particular, I would mention that the storage of the returned sub-object is shared with the parent object, just to make it explicit. The concept looks ok.
Again, my concern is that to be able to use this new intrinsic from clang by default will take a lot of work. You'll likely face many perf regressions before patching a bunch of optimizations.
